You don't need to form a company, simple SA for your rental income is sufficient .... it does sound from your post that some professional one to one guidance is really reqd here .... just until you get the basic hang of things.
Regarding late pens, you'll have to bite the bullet if HMRC won't be flexible - you need to plead ignorance and see how they will apply any penalty, and if they will allow you to spread payment of any pens over an extended timeframe.

for whomever is in the same situation as me i called them up and they said i should not expect a fine etc and were very friendly .
i have also found a document which is penalties for late declaration. what i pasted earlier was for late return which is different
